LAY-OFFS HIT H.S.A.S. MEMBERS On February 9, 1993 the provincial government announced it was cutting funding to regional services effective March 31, 1993. One has to question the timing of the government's decision. For example if they had waited until the affected Health Districts were established before eliminating the funding our members may have been able to transfer their employment without disrupting patient care. However, this would require forethought, planning and commitment to both patient care and front line health care workers.

1992 ANNUAL GENERAL MEETING The Annual General Meeting of H.S.A.S. was held Saturday, October 24, 1992 at the Saskatoon Inn. In attendance were 48 members from Prince Albert, Saskatoon and Regina, two guests and the Executive Director. Lorne Calvert, Associate Minister of Health, opened the session with a talk on Saskatchewan's health care system. He spoke about; the history of health care in the province, fiscal realities facing the health care system and the government's wellness initiative. Upon completion of Mr. Calvert's presentation a lively question period ensued. This was followed by the business meeting with Ted Makeechak serving as Chairperson. Following the presentation of various reports, elections were held to fill the following vacant positions on Executive Council; Dietitians, Laboratory Technologists, Psychologists, Radiology and Nuclear Medicine Technologists and Speech Language Pathologists and Orthoptists. Immediately following adjournment of the meeting Nancy Glover (a Physical Therapist at Saskatoon City Hospital) and Julie Gordon (a Physical Therapist at Royal Univers ity Hospital) were drawn as the winners of the two $100.00 cash prizes. The social held after the meeting provided members an opportunity to meet and mingle. For those of you who were unable to attend please contact the H.S.A.S. office should you wish to review the various reports that were presented .
